Summary
Werner Bormann is a human[1]. Born in Berlin[2], he… he was born on October 27, 1931[3]. He died in Hamburg[4]. He died on May 16, 2013[5]. He worked as an economist[6] and Esperantist[7].

Body
Origins and Family
Born in Berlin[2], Werner Bormann… he was born on October 27, 1931[3]. His father was Artur Bormann[8]. German was his native language[13].
Education
Werner Bormann earned the academic degree of doctorate[23].
Career and Affiliations
Recorded occupations include economist[6] and Esperantist[7]. Positions held include president of the Academy of Esperanto[14] and President of the German Esperanto Association[15], a position[27].
Recognition
Awards received include Honorary Member of the World Esperanto Association[16], an award[28] and Honorary member of the German Esperanto Association[17], an award[29].
Personal Life
Werner Bormann was married to Elsbeth Bormann[9]. Children include Judith Jackson[10], an Esperantist[30], b. 1963[31], of Germany[32] and Thomas Bormann[11], an Esperantist[33], b. 1958[34], of Germany[35].
Death and Burial
Werner Bormann died on May 16, 2013[5]. He died in Hamburg[4].
